VOIX'ANO KALAIKA NOKMAU
HUA), Hawaii, T. II., Dec. 26 The
volcano of Kalauea has returned to
its normal state following unusual
activity which continued for several
weeks, and during which thousands of
tons of lava were forced through the
cracks in the floor of the old crater
which surrounds the boiling fire lake.
The central lava pit ha descended to
a depth of 100 feet. Another spectac
ular display in 11120 is forecast by sci
entists of the volcano observatory.

It Kit UN IS IN MAI) SHAPE S
LONDON, Dec, 27. (United Press)
Mutinous sailors seized rifles and
joined in the defense of the royal pal
ace against the Loyal Uuard, accord
ing to dispatches filed in Berlin Wed- j
nesduy night and received by the I-on-don
Express today. The sailors also
agreed to a surrender, but refused to
'leave the city. They announced they
would continue to support Chancellor
Ebert. The city is on the verge of
anarchy and fighting is expected to
continue, the dispatch stated.

Jl'DCKS ARE ELECTED
PARIS, Dec. 27. (United Press)
The llolsheviki have occupied the
courts in Essen, ejecting all judges,
, according to a Zurich dispatch re
; ceived by the Paris Journal. The Ger
' man press, said the dispatch, is be
coming very pessimistic over the new j
revolt. ' ;
